Gerald W. Rowe

February 12, 1927 — July 3, 2022

Gerald Wesley “Jerry” Rowe, 95, lifetime resident of Norwich, passed away Sunday, July 3, 2022 at home with his family by his side.

Jerry was born February 12, 1927 on Roweview Farm in Norwich, the son of Charles Wesley and Elsie (Phetteplace) Rowe. Jerry met his wife Agnes (Meyer) through the local 4-H clubs. On November 21, 1948 they married.

Jerry graduated from Norwich High School in 1945 at which time his grandfather bought him an English Draft horse. He bought the second one from Cornell University to make a team for farming. Jerry was a third-generation farmer on Roweview Farm, working with his father and later on with his two sons and a grandson. He enjoyed his neighborhood card games where they played pitch for over 60 years. Jerry was involved in many associations, including Eastern AI Breeder Association (Delegate Member), Agway, Dairymen’s League, Pamona Grange, Farm Bureau, Holstein Friesian Association, Cornell Cooperative Extension of Chenango County, Brown Swiss Association, and Evergreen Cemetery Association.

Jerry is survived by his children, Grace (Bohdan) Krawczuk, of West Seneca, NY, Katheryn (Philip) Inglis, of Milton, PA, Charles (Doreen) Rowe, of Norwich, Mary (Darryl) Traver, of Deland, FL, Robert (Sheryl) Rowe, of Norwich, and Barbara Jenne, of Sherburne; 13 grandchildren; 20 great-grandchildren; one great-great grandchild; and sister, Betty Wade, of Bainbridge, NY. Jerry was predeceased by his wife, Agnes, and sister, Beverly Laughlin.
